During fermentation, yeast usually consumes sugar and converts into ethanol (ethyl/drinking alcohol) and carbon dioxide gas. This phenomenon is usually observable during the process of making bread (letting the dough rise) or brewing beer (adding yeast into a liquid that contains sugars that come from boiling malted grains [malting is a process in which the seeds be allowed to partially germinate to convert the contents of the grains into sugar] to release the sugars into the water).

Is bubble an adjective or part of the noun in the word bubble gum?

The word 'bubble' is both a verb (bubble, bubbles, bubbling, bubbled) and a noun (bubble, bubbles). The adjective form is bubbly. The word 'bubble gum' is a compound noun, an open spaced compound noun; two words joined to form a noun with its own meaning.

Are there expressions with the word bubble?

Yes, expressions like "bubble up" meaning to rise to the surface, "living in a bubble" suggesting someone is isolated from reality, and "bursting the bubble" signifying a sudden end to a period of optimism or false hope all use the word "bubble."
